Master of Accounting (M.Acc.) at Penn State University Fees
To get admission in Master of Accounting (M.Acc.) at Pennsylvania State University-University Park students need to cover tuition fees and living costs. The fee structure varies based on whether the student is domestic or international. For international students the tuition fee for the first year is USD 40,812. Master of Accounting (M.Acc.) at Penn State University Entry Requirements
- No specific cutoff mentioned
- CGPA - 3/4
- Read less
- Undergraduates with or without an accounting background are both welcome to apply to the Penn State Smeal College of Business Master of Accounting program.
- Students who apply to the program should have an undergraduate educational background equivalent to a Bachelor of Science degree from the Penn State University Smeal College of Business. Students who apply to the program should have completed the equivalent of the following Penn State University courses:
- Financial and Managerial Accounting for Decision Making
- Auditing
- Managerial Accounting: Economic Perspective
- Principles of Taxation I
- Intermediate Financial Accounting I & II
- Business Analytics
- In addition, an applicant is expected to have maintained a grade-point average of 3.00 for the required accounting courses.
